Document Description
In order to recover and rehabilitate forest land impacted by fire and insect attack, it is necessary to harvest conifer cones across the state for current and future reforestation projects. Mature cones from conifer trees from various seeds zone will be collected/harvested. The harvest method will be to hand climb selected seed trees and harvest cones using simple hand tools (pole saw and pole pruners) Once cones are removed from trees they will be dropped to the ground and put in to bags. The bags of cones will then be transported to a temporary holding facility and then eventually transported to CAL FIRE's State Seed Bank at the L. A. Moran Reforestation Center in Davis, California for processing.

Reasons for Exemption
This project fits under portions of this project is being considered exempt from the provisions of CEQA under 14 CCR, Ch. 3, Article 19, Section 15304. Field review by CAL FIRE staff confirmed that no exceptions apply that would preclude the use of a notice of exemption for this project. The Department has concluded that no significant environmental impact would occur to aesthetics, agriculture and forestland or timberland, air quality, biological resources, cultural resources, geology and soils, greenhouse gas emissions, hazards and hazardous materials, hydrology and water quality, land use planning, mineral resources, noise, population and housing, public services, recreation, transportation or traffic, or to utilities and service systems. Documentation of the environmental review completed by the Department is kept on file at 1234 East Shaw Avenue Fresno CA. This project qualifies as a Class 4 exemption for minor public or private alterations to land, water or vegetation which do not involve the removal of healthy, mature, scenic trees. Under Section 15323, a project is exempt if the project consists of minor alterations to land, water or vegetation.
